@59 Kaiser Mazoku: "Unless I'm mistaken, it falls in the "yaoi" category, which is porn."

"Yaoi" is synonymous with "porn" only under the technical Japanese definition of the term, which no-one except hardcore manga nerds use in the Anglophone world. Even US publishers use "yaoi" as a general term for Boys' Love Genre works.
